Buying Guide
You want ropes that feel safe. You want gear that works. You want every trip to feel smooth and easy.
-
Strength: Pick ropes with high break strength. They hold firm when the water gets rough. They keep your boat steady.
-
Material: Choose nylon for stretch and power. It stays strong in sun and water. It lasts a long time.
-
Length: Match the rope length to your boat size. Short ropes work for small docks. Long ropes help in deep or wide spots.
-
Thickness: Thicker ropes give better grip and more strength. They feel solid in your hands. They stay steady under load.
-
Loops: Look for pre‑spliced loops. They make tying fast and simple. They save time when docking.
-
Weather Resistance: Pick ropes that resist sun, salt, and water wear. They stay smooth. They stay strong.
-
Stretch Level: Low‑stretch ropes keep your boat still. High‑stretch ropes soften pulls and shocks. Choose what fits your style.
-
Handling: Soft ropes feel good in your hands. They bend easy. They tie clean.
-
Durability: Heat‑sealed ends stop fray. Double‑braid builds power. These features keep ropes ready for years.
-
Use Case: Docking, towing, or anchoring each need the right rope. Pick the rope made for your task. It keeps your boat safe.
